1. The Appeal of Off-Roading: Advantages of 4x4s

Off-Road Capability and Freedom to Explore

The 4x4 excels in its ability to break free from the limitations of paved roads. Thanks to its four-wheel drive, it takes you where vans fear to tread: steep mountain trails, vast deserts, and sandy beaches. For those thirsty for freedom, the 4x4 opens the door to boundless exploration, offering wild camping sites inaccessible to less robust vehicles.

Robustness and Security

With a 4x4, ruggedness is guaranteed. Capable of carrying everything you need for an adventure in the great outdoors, it also provides greater safety thanks to its structure designed to withstand the harshest conditions. What's more, the extra height offered by a 4x4 can be an advantage when installing a roof tent, providing breathtaking views of your wild corner of paradise.

2. The House on Wheels: Advantages of the Van

Comfort and Amenities

The van is often associated with a home on wheels, offering a more spacious and comfortable living space. Ideal for those who prioritize the comfort and conveniences of home (kitchen, living space, sometimes even a bathroom), the van allows for a traveling adventure without sacrificing well-being. The extra space is also perfect for storing your roof tent when you're not in exploration mode.

Lifestyle and Community

Choosing a van often means embracing a lifestyle, that of vanlifers, a community of travelers who share the same quest for freedom and adventure, but with a touch of comfort. Van gatherings are opportunities to share experiences and travel tips, creating a unique sense of belonging to this nomadic culture.
